HELSINKI, Jan 13 (Reuters) - A nuclear power plant under construction by the Franco-German Areva-Siemens consortium in Finland will be further delayed to mid-2012, utility TVO said on Tuesday.

"The Areva-Siemens Consortium, the turn-key supplier of the Olkiluoto 3 nuclear power plant unit, has now confirmed TVO´s earlier estimation that the Olkiluoto 3 unit will not be completed until 2012," TVO said in a statement.

"Areva-Siemens (CEPFi.PA)(SIEGn.DE) has projected completion in June 2012."

The 1,600 MW reactor -- the first to be constructed in Western Europe for more than a decade -- has been delayed for several times from its initial start-up target of 2009. (Reporting by Sakari Suoninen; Editing by David Cowell)
